With all the hype about how great the weighted blanket can help insomnia, I got myself one to see if it can help me to sleep better. First of all, the blanket is heavy. It has a soft cotton duvet with zipper outside. I think it weights around 15 lbs as described. I read somewhere that you need to chose the right weight of the blanket in order for it to work, which is 10% of your weight. So I am about 140lbs, and the 15 lbs blanket is right for me. To be honest, for the first couple days using it, I do not like it at all because it’s so heavy, so every time I turn, I feel like I have to lift the blanket up to turn. Secondly, it’s not breathable so that it makes me sweat a lot in hot days. However, after more than a month using it, I think I get used to it and it actually helps me sleep better. It did not help me to fall asleep, but to help me sleep deeper and stay in sleep longer. And as the weather is getting colder, it now can keep me warm at night because I feel it traps all my body heat inside the blanket. If the blanket can be used in warmer weather, it would have been perfect.
